Types of Isolation in Modern Inverters

  • Galvanic Isolation: Uses transformers to physically separate DC and AC circuits
  • High-Frequency Transformer Isolation: Compact solution for space-constrained installations
  • Transformerless Designs: Requires advanced monitoring systems for safety compliance

Future Trends in Inverter Isolation

  • Smart isolation systems with AI-powered fault prediction
  • Modular isolation units for easy maintenance
  • Nanocrystalline core transformers reducing energy loss

FAQ: Grid-Connected Inverter Isolation

  • Q: Can I retrofit isolation to existing inverters?A: Possible but requires professional assessment of system compatibility
  • Q: How often should isolation components be tested?A: Minimum annual inspection recommended by IEEE 1547 standards
  • Q: Does isolation affect system efficiency?A: Modern solutions keep losses below 0.5% through advanced magnetic materials
